Fire damages residential house in Sopore

Sopore, May 27 : A residential house was damaged in a fire incident in north Kashmir’s Sopore township during the night, reports said.

Residential house of Javeed Ahmed Kanna son of Ghulam Mohammad Kanna of Kralteng Sopore was gutted completely in a fire mishap during the night, reports said.

Reports added that the timely action of locals and fire brigade officials managed to douse the flames and saved other residential houses.

However, no loss of life of injury was reported in the mishap, while the cause of the fire was not known immediately.

Meanwhile police took cognizance of this fire mishap.
